This article defines a tensor (viz a section on a tensor bundle over the manifold) of type (0,2)

Definition

Given data

A manifold M with a connection on it. BY default, we may take a Riemannian manifold and consider the Levi-Civita connection on it.

Definition part

The Einstein tensor is a (0,2)-tensor that takes as input two vector fields and outputs a scalar function, as follows.

(X,Y)Ric(X,Y)(1/2)Rg(X,Y)

where Ric(X,Y) denotes the Ricci curvature tensor and R denotes the scalar curvature function.
